Doctor of Business Administration

A doctorate in business prepares you to conduct applied research in specific business disciplines, allowing you to pursue an advanced career in corporations, banks, government agencies, and research-oriented consulting positions.

The Olin Business School Doctor of Business Administration (DBA) degree program offers you a collaborative atmosphere centered on industry-relevant applied research in Finance, Marketing, or Supply Chain, Operations, and Technology. This advanced graduate program crosses traditional boundaries and provides you the opportunity, under the guidance of Washington University faculty, for structured course work along with focused, independent scholarly reading and research on important issues relating to business.

The Olin DBA program is a 72-credit-hour STEM-designated doctoral degree designed for individuals with a serious interest in finance or marketing research who wish to pursue graduate study either on a part-time or full-time basis. Learn more about STEM.

A practitioner’s doctoral degree designed for professionals conducting applied research outside of academia

A Doctor in Business Administration is an advanced graduate degree that differs from a traditional PhD and extends beyond the fundamental foundation of a master’s degree to develop the necessary skills to conduct applied research. The DBA differs from a master’s degree and a PhD in a number of ways, including the scope of study, the approach to research, and essentially the definitive outcome.

The Olin DBA is designed to meet the needs of the researching professional, rather than the professional researcher. While a PhD is intended for those who wish to pursue research careers in academia, the DBA is extended graduate study beyond a master’s degree for those who wish to pursue careers in corporations, consulting firms, or government agencies that can benefit from advanced research skills in analyzing business problems. The research capabilities developed in the DBA programs for finance and marketing are of a more applied nature, with more immediate real-world applicability than typical research pursued in the PhD program. Unlike the PhD program, the DBA program is aimed at those who are working in industry and may continue to work during their enrollment in the DBA program. Classes are held on site at Washington University in St. Louis. Emphasis is on collaborative research and top-tier teaching by faculty, there is not an online or distance component to the Olin DBA program.
